Q&M Dental to acquire Veritas Dental for $800,000

The proposed acquisition is in line with Q&M Dental’s plan to continue the expansion of its main dental business in Singapore.

Q&M Dental has entered into a binding memorandum of understanding with Veritas Dental and its 90% legal and beneficial owner Dr Sebrina Abdul Malik to acquire Veritas’s dental clinic business for $800,000.

Veritas operates a dental clinic business at 781 Bukit Timah Road. Based on the unaudited accounts of Veritas for the financial year ended Dec 31, 2023, the net book value of the assets of the business was $203,486.

The purchase consideration takes into account the history, track record and future prospects of the business, as well as Dr Sebrina’s professional expertise, among others.

The proposed acquisition is in line with Q&M Dental’s plan to continue the expansion of its main dental business in Singapore. It is not expected to have any material effect on the net tangible assets per share and the earnings per share of the company for the current financial year ending Dec 31.

Shares in Q&M Dental closed 0.5 cents higher or 1.8% up on Sept 10 at 28 cents.
